Police Log

Theft: Several items were stolen from an unlocked apartment at Cedar Lofts East, 711 E. Beaver Ave., at about 4:16 a.m. Saturday, State College Police said. The stolen items, valued at more than $1,000, included a laptop computer, an iPod, stereo and multi-disc CD player.

Assault: State College Police said a man was assaulted by an unknown man outside of Mad Mex, 200 S. Pugh St., at 3:07 a.m. Saturday. The victim sustained a laceration to the inside of his upper lip, police said. The suspect was identified and charges of simple assault will be filed, police said.

Theft: A bicycle was stolen from the bicycle rack near Geary Hall between March 13 and Friday, Penn State University Police said. The Schwinn bicycle is valued at $800.
